My Buying Guides on Best Head Pins For Earrings
When I first started making my own earrings, I quickly realized that choosing the right head pins is crucial. They might seem like small, simple components, but the quality and type of head pins can make or break your jewelry projects. Here’s what I’ve learned about picking the best head pins for earrings.
1. Material Matters
From my experience, the material of the head pins affects both durability and appearance. Common materials include:
- Sterling Silver: Perfect for a classic look and hypoallergenic properties. I always use these when making earrings for sensitive ears.
- Gold-Filled or Gold-Plated: These give a luxurious finish but can vary in quality. I recommend gold-filled for better longevity.
- Copper and Brass: Great for vintage or rustic styles. They’re affordable but may tarnish over time.
- Stainless Steel: Extremely durable and hypoallergenic, ideal if you want long-lasting pieces.
2. Gauge and Thickness
Choosing the right thickness is essential. I generally use 20-22 gauge head pins for earrings because they’re sturdy enough to hold beads without bending too easily, but still thin enough to work with. Thinner gauges (24+) are more delicate and better for lightweight designs, but they can be fragile.
3. Length of the Head Pins
I always pick head pins slightly longer than the beads I plan to use so I have enough length to create loops and secure the beads properly. Standard lengths range from 1 inch to 3 inches. For layered or multi-bead earrings, longer pins are a must.
4. Style of the Head Pin Head
Head pins come with different types of heads: flat, ball, or decorative. I usually choose flat heads because they hold beads securely and create a neat finish. However, ball or decorative heads can add an extra design element if you want the pin head to show.
5. Corrosion Resistance
If you want your earrings to last, especially if they might get exposed to moisture or sweat, look for head pins that resist tarnishing and corrosion. Sterling silver and stainless steel are my go-to materials for this reason.
6. Quantity and Packaging
I often buy head pins in bulk to save money and ensure I have plenty on hand. However, I make sure the packaging keeps them organized and prevents tangling, which can be a hassle.
7. Price vs. Quality
It’s tempting to buy the cheapest head pins, but I’ve found that investing a bit more in quality pays off. Cheap pins tend to bend, break, or tarnish quickly, making my crafting frustrating.
